Fritzi is a diminutive form of the German name Friederike, derived from Old High German elements 'fridu' meaning 'peace' and 'ric' meaning 'ruler' or 'power.' Historically, it was used as an affectionate or familiar nickname for girls named Friederike, suggesting a young or beloved peaceful ruler. The name embodies a sense of calm leadership and strength wrapped in endearment.

Cultural Significance of Fritzi

Fritzi has roots deeply embedded in German culture as a familiar and affectionate diminutive of Friederike, a name borne by several German queens and noblewomen. The name captures a sense of warmth and familial closeness, often used in intimate social contexts. Its usage peaked in German-speaking countries during the early to mid-20th century and is sometimes associated with traditional German folk stories and characters, reflecting a nostalgic charm.

Friederike Caroline Neuber

An influential 18th-century German actress and theater director who helped develop German theater.

Friederike of Mecklenburg-Strelitz

Queen consort of Prussia as wife of Frederick William III, known for her cultural patronage.

Friederike Brion

The muse and first love of Johann Wolfgang von Goethe, inspiring some of his earliest poetry.
